It’s a completely different fabric & you get to choose your fabric. So, I went with the Belgian linen… the texture is amazing & it adds a whole new element to this room. The one disappointment for me was that I couldn’t get a pure linen blend for this sofa because it’s not made for the sectional, so I will be doing that on other sofas in our home for sure! But the belgian linen was my second choice & I’m actually super happy we went with it for this sofa for a few reasons. It’s durable, doesn’t wrinkle like a pure linen would, super thick & sturdy which helps the structure of the sofa look like new, & is a little more loose so it’s easy to put the cushions in the slipcover.
